Egyptian Cotton Bedding: Keeping It Luxurious

Egyptian cotton bedding is very luxurious and in high demand because of its quality and ability to endure for a long period of time. It is grown in Egypt because the climate is perfect for growing this type of cotton plant. Though it is high quality, it still needs to be taken care of properly. There are some guidelines you should follow to keep the colors vibrant and the bedding looking brand new.

Luxury Bed Sheets - Maintenance With Ease

Usually, the label on the bedding will tell you how to wash it. Use the recommendations given by the manufacturer for maximum benefit. The label will also tell you how much of the bedding is Egyptian cotton and how much of other material is used.

Egyptian cotton bedding set can be machine washed and the temperature of the water used will depend on the color of the bedding. It can be spot cleaned also to eliminate a stain. Always use the gentle machine wash cycle to prevent damage to the sheets or comforters. If you have a dark color set then use warmer water and for lighter colors use cold water to wash it.

If You Want To Hand Wash

If you are washing your Egyptian cotton bedding by hand then you should fill your bathtub with water that is warm. Use mild laundry detergent to clean the material. Direct tap water should work fine but you'll get a better result if you use filtered water. Many houses have whole house filters installed. Once clean, rinse with water and eliminate all of the remaining water.

You can also spot clean your Egyptian cotton bedding sets by using a spray bottle to clean only the area that needs to be cleaned. Gently scrub the affected area with a soft cloth. A wet washcloth works well for this purpose. Allow the item to dry at room temperature or allow the sun in from the window to let it dry. You can spray the item so it smells better. Fabric refresher is a good idea to serve this purpose.

Egyptian cotton bedding can be dried in the dryer but it should always be on the lowest setting. Never use high heat and do not use softener sheets during the drying process because this will prevent the cotton from being breathable. This type of cotton is well known for its breathability and that last thing you want to do is eliminate this feature. The bedding can also be hung on the laundry line outside to try outside. This method can be used only during the warmer months and is not appropriate for year round use.

Egyptian Cotton Bedding - Ironing Optional

The bedding, if it fits on your bed properly, will not need ironing. Simply pull it into place and smooth it down by hand. If you do want to iron it, use the lowest setting to prevent it from being burned. Iron the bedding using an ironing board just like you would for clothes. Because of the weight, it is best to prop the un-ironed portion on something to prevent it from sliding off the ironing board.
